DAILY PROGRAM & ACTIVITIES
![]() |
Structured Swim - All campers receive evaluation and daily YMCA structured swim in our outdoor pool. |
|
Horseback Riding - Campers in the Tonaweh, Oyaneh and Sachem units are introduced to animal care and riding skills.

FEATURE ACTIVITIES:
|
Overnights - Each two week session
features one overnight for the Tonawehs, Oyanehs and Sachems. For a small
fee, campers get to enjoy the Camp Iroquois Overnight experience which
includes dinner, games, a silent hike, campfire activities (including
s'mores, bug juice & stories), and breakfast. Campers may even choose
to camp out under the stars (weather permitting)!
